Figure 2. Pathologic findings. (A) Gross photographic image of resected specimen. Arrowhead identifies the tumor stalk. Scale = 1 inch. (B) Histologic sections showed an organizing thrombus with a polypoid architecture (hematoxylin and eosin [H&E] stain). (C) Dense foci of atypical cells were predominantly arranged along the surface (H&E stain). (D) Malignant cells were round to lobated, with vesicular chromatin and prominent nucleoli. Apoptotic cells and mitoses were numerous (H&E stain). (E) Occasional cells with cytoplasmic pseudoinclusions were observed (H&E stain). (F) Positive immunohistochemical staining with antibody to CD20 (immunoperoxidase). (G) Positive immunohistochemical staining with antibody to CD30 (immunoperoxidase). Original magnifications: panel B, × 2; panels C and F, × 10; panels D and E, × 100; panel G, × 40.
